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s
Step 1: Preheat the Air Fryer
Start by preheating your air fryer to 350°F (175°C). This prepares the environment for cooking the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s, ensuring they become perfectly golden brown and crispy. Take a moment to gather all your ingredients and equipment, making the subsequent steps smooth and easy.
Step 2: Prepare the Dough
Carefully open the crescent roll dough package and unroll it on a clean surface. Separate the dough into 8 triangles, making sure each piece is free from the other to allow for easy wrapping. These flaky triangles will form the delicious outer layer of your apple pie bombs, ready to embrace the scrumptious filling.
Step 3: Add the Filling
In the center of each dough triangle, scoop about 1 tablespoon of apple pie filling. Make sure to place the filling generously, ensuring that each bomb has the perfect ratio of pastry to sweet apple goodness. This step is crucial for a delightful burst of flavor in every bite.
Step 4: Seal the Bombs
Gently fold the edges of the dough triangle over the filling, pinching the seams together tightly to seal in the deliciousness. It's important to ensure there are no open gaps; otherwise, the filling might leak out while cooking. A well-sealed bomb guarantees an enticing gooey center once cooked.
Step 5: Brush with Butter
Using a pastry brush, evenly coat each dough bomb with melted unsalted butter. This step not only adds richness but also helps the sugar and cinnamon mixture adhere to the surface for a beautifully crispy topping. Watch as the warm butter glistens on the dough, preparing it for the next flavorful touch.
Step 6: Mix Sugar and Cinnamon
In a small bowl, combine the granulated sugar and ground cinnamon until well mixed. This aromatic blend will elevate the sweetness and spice of your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s. Once combined, roll each butter-coated dough bomb in this mixture, ensuring every surface is generously covered for that perfect sweet crunch.
Step 7: Arrange in the Air Fryer
Carefully arrange the coated dough balls in a single layer within the air fryer basket, making sure they do not touch each other. This placement allows for even air circulation, ensuring all sides cook to a golden perfection. Give them enough space to expand as they cook, creating a delightful pastry delight.
Step 8: Air Fry to Perfection
Cook your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s in the preheated air fryer for about 7-9 minutes. Keep an eye on them, checking for a golden brown color and the unmistakable aroma of baked pastry filling the air. They are done when they are crispy on the outside and your kitchen is enveloped in the sweet scent of cinnamon and apples.
Step 9: Cool and Serve
Once cooked, carefully remove the apple pie bombs from the air fryer and allow them to cool slightly on a wire rack. This step is essential to maintain their crispiness and prevent sogginess. After a few moments, serve these delightful treats warm, either on their own or with a scoop of vanilla ice cream for an extra treat.

Storage Tips for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s
-
Room Temperature: Allow the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s to cool before leaving them out. They can be stored at room temperature for up to 4-6 hours in an airtight container for optimal freshness.
-
Fridge: If not eaten within a few hours, refrigerate the bombs in an airtight container for up to 48 hours. Reheat them in the air fryer for about 3-5 minutes to restore their crispness.
-
Freezer: To store long-term, freeze uncoated bombs on a baking sheet until solid, then transfer them to a freezer bag. Air fry from frozen for 10-12 minutes when ready to serve.
-
Reheating: For best results, reheat the bombs in the air fryer to keep them crispy instead of using a microwave. This way, you will enjoy that delightful texture again!

Expert Tips for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s
-
Sealing Technique: Ensure all seams are pinched tightly to prevent the filling from leaking during cooking. Dab a little water on the edges for better adhesion.
-
Oven Watch: Keep a close eye on your bombs after 7 minutes to avoid burning. Each air fryer can vary in cooking speed, so adjust as needed.
-
Cooling Matters: Allow the bombs to cool slightly on a wire rack after frying. This keeps them crispy and prevents sogginess from trapped steam.
-
Custom Flavoring: Feel free to experiment! Swap in different fruit fillings like cherry or peach for unique flavor combinations with these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s.
-
Butter Brushing: Don’t skimp on the melted butter – it’s essential for achieving that rich, golden, and crispy crust that will make each bite unforgettable.
Make Ahead Options
These Air Fryer Apple Pie Bombs are a fantastic choice for meal prep and can save you precious time on busy days! You can prepare the dough and fill each bomb up to 24 hours in advance; just keep them covered in the refrigerator to maintain freshness and prevent drying out. Additionally, you can freeze the uncoated bombs for up to 3 months; simply place them on a baking sheet to freeze, then transfer to an airtight container. When you're ready to enjoy, air fry them directly from frozen for 10-12 minutes.
